Giraffe and Animals

Robin Hansen Buchholz hopes to find a quilt that has been missing since Spring 1993. It was last seen at Tillamook Junior High School during a show-and-tell session. Her daughter brought it to her eighth grade class for a report on pioneers. She took an antique crazy quilt throw, an example of an Hawaiian quilt square in blue and white, an appliqu�d quilt top of a dinosaur sitting on an egg, and an embroidered quilt wall hanging we called my "Giraffe Quilt". This was a quilt that I had dreamed of doing. I woke up one night about 2am in the mid-1980's, after seeing this quilt in a dream. It would use up all the whimsical patterns from cards that my boyfriend in high school had sent me when I was laid up from a bike accident. It had a large giraffe in the middle, surrounded by animals and flowers � all embroidered � mostly in satin stitch. It had the first lines from "All things bright and beautiful!" poem on the quilt.

Please contact Robin at [email protected] if you have this quilt.
